# Financial Templates

Financial Templates is the non-API pillar of the stock-analysis skill. These files are
template and instruction patterns only. They do not fetch data, do not make live
claims, and do not replace source-grounded research.

## Usage Rules

- Clearly label outputs from this pillar as **templates** or **analysis
  frameworks** unless populated with verified data.
- If the user asks for prices, filings, news, or fundamentals, follow
  `../data/SKILL.md`: direct API for the two-date price edge, Data Lake for
  historical and non-price facts. State every source and date range.
- If the user asks for strategy performance, route to `../backtesting/SKILL.md`.
- Do not invent financial figures. Use placeholders like `<Revenue>` or cite the
  data source used to fill them.
- Include date ranges, currency, units, and source provenance fields in any
  populated template.
